Описание тега coin-or-clp

Clp (Coin-OR linear programming) - решающая программа для линейного программирования с открытым исходным кодом, написанная на C++. Это часть проекта COIN-OR (Вычислительная инфраструктура для исследования операций), коллекции программного обеспечения с открытым исходным кодом для сообщества исследователей операций.
0 ответов

Как я могу создать наборы связанных опций с COIN-OR CLP

Я использую COIN-OR CLP ( https://projects.coin-or.org/Clp) для настройки линейной программы на Python. Привязки Python с монетой были ранее настроены в другом проекте. Есть 5 разных типов строк ('L', 'E', 'G', 'R', or 'N'), которые могут быть добав…
06 дек '18 в 10:23
1 ответ

Цель Нижняя граница команды? Использование PULP с COIN_CMD/CBC/CLP

Я использую PULP для решения LP с CBC с разрывом трещины (epgap) 0,01 (99,99%). Есть ли команда для возврата лучшей нижней границы, найденной после завершения решателя? Таким образом, независимо от того, что решатель сравнивает объективное значение …
0 ответов

Clp находит оптимальное решение и затем становится невозможным

Я использую COIN OR Clp для решения некоторых математических моделей. В целом я очень доволен, однако некоторые проблемы неосуществимы. После двойной проверки с помощью gurobi я обнаружил, что есть оптимальное решение этих проблем, и Clp действитель…
0 ответов

Как настроить линейную программу в COIN-OR Clp?

Я использую COIN-OR Clp, и мне нужно определить мою линейную задачу в C++. Я могу построить мою проблему в терминах матрицы и вектора ограничений, но я не понимаю формат, в котором Clp нуждается в этой информации. Как мне структурировать CoinPackedM…
1 ответ

Монета или - использование в моем проекте

Я хотел бы использовать COIN-OR в качестве разделяемой библиотеки для моего собственного проекта. Есть ли у вас какая-либо ссылка для создания COIN-OR в качестве разделяемой библиотеки и включения ее в мой проект, включая демонстрацию CMakeList?
09 апр '18 в 20:02
1 ответ

CMake ExternalProject_Add использует автоматически установленные переменные

Согласно документации, ExternalProject_Add устанавливает неустановленные переменные каталога самостоятельно. Если какой-либо из перечисленных выше параметров..._DIR не указан, их значения по умолчанию рассчитываются следующим образом. Если задана оп…
05 сен '18 в 08:43
0 ответов

mingw в rtools ld.exe не может найти указанные библиотеки?

Я пытаюсь скомпилировать R пакет pcaL1 из исходного кода для создания pcaL1.dll с Rtools, как показано ниже: c:/Rtools/mingw_32/bin/gcc -shared -s -static-libgcc -o pcaL1.dll pcaL1- win.def init.o l1pca.o l1pca_R.o l1pcahp.o l1pcahp_R.o l1pcastar.o …
22 мар '18 в 19:20
0 ответов

CBC зависает после поиска оптимального решения

Я пытаюсь использовать CBC для решения файла MPS. Он часто зависает на длительные периоды времени и выходит без каких-либо сообщений. Он также будет зависать даже после того, как найдет оптимальное решение. Я не знаю, почему это не возвращается, что…
16 май '19 в 08:13
1 ответ

Pyomo - Расположение файлов журнала

Довольно простой вопрос, но где я могу найти файлы журналов решателя от Pyomo? У меня локальная установка решателей COIN-OR на машине с Ubuntu. Это происходит в записной книжке Jupyter, но я получаю то же сообщение об ошибке при запуске файла.py из …
15 июн '19 в 05:22
0 ответов

как я могу изменить нижнюю границу с помощью JuMP 0.19

У меня есть переменная x где его нижняя граница определялась как lb=zeros(3), после этого я хочу изменить для каждого элемента lb быть равным элементу массива, например c=[1;2;1] я хочу именно сделать lb[i]=c[i] for i=1:length(c) В предыдущих версия…
0 ответов

Выбор сводных правил в симплексе

Я пытаюсь решить простую проблему LP, используя cylpбиблиотека. Прямо сейчас я использую этот код, который реализован для решения проблемы с помощью симплексного метода: from cylp.cy import CyClpSimplex from cylp.py.pivots import PositiveEdgePivot i…
0 ответов

Как разрешить Coin-or Cbc Solver записывать файл решения?

Я использую библиотеку C++ COIN-OR Cbc Solver для решения некоторых проблем LP. И я нигде не могу найти функцию или что-то, что записывает файл решения. Я думаю, что где-то в коде есть эта функция, потому что вы можете использовать интерфейс командн…
04 май '22 в 10:45